Schloss Ortenburg, also referred to as Schloss Unterhaus or Paternschloss, is a significant historical site located in the village of Unterhaus, within the municipality of Baldramsdorf in Carinthia. This 18th-century building is a protected monument, offering visitors a glimpse into the architectural styles and historical significance of the period.
The Schloss Ortenburg is home to the "1. Kärntner Handwerksmuseum" or the 1st Carinthian Crafts Museum. This museum showcases over 40 fully equipped workshops from past centuries, providing a unique insight into the region's rich craft heritage.
Since 2015, the entire second floor of Schloss Ortenburg has been dedicated to one of Austria's most significant collections of Chinese artifacts. With approximately 2300 objects on display, visitors can explore a wide range of Chinese cultural and historical artifacts.
